Fish & Veggie Stainless Grill Tray Specs & Features

traeger-modifire-fish-veggie-tray-studio-front.png

SKU BAC610
Dimensions 18.25” x 10.16” x 2.6”
Materials Brushed stainless steel
Grill Compatibility

Fits perfectly on ModiFIRE®-compatible grill grates. 

Features
  • Handles allow easy lifting and precise placement
  • Keeps small or flaky food from falling through grates
  • Ideal for fish, veggies, and more
  • Brushed stainless steel is durable and easy to clean

 

Grill Compatibility

ModiFIRE accessories are designed to fit perfectly on ModiFIRE®-compatible grill grates, but can still be used with most Traeger grills. Grills with ModiFIRE®-compatible grill grates include Traeger Touchscreen WiFIRE-enabled grills:

  • Ironwood
  • Ironwood XL
  • Timberline
  • Timberline XL

The ModiFIRE Fish & Veggie Stainless Steel Grill Tray is the perfect size to fit parallel with the grill grates, as seen in the image below.

traeger-modifire-fish-veggie-tray-lifestlye-1.jpg

Grills that do not have ModiFIRE®-compatible grill grates can still use the ModiFIRE Fish & Veggie Stainless Steel Grill Tray, though you may need to adjust the position the tray on the grates — rotating it 90° to sit perpendicular to the grill grates. 

Seasoning a Fish & Veggie Stainless Steel Grill Tray

Similar to cast iron accessories, the ModiFIRE Fish & Veggie Stainless Steel Grill Tray needs to be seasoned prior to use and may require additional seasoning throughout its lifespan.

  • Increases nonstick feature
  • Prevents discoloration

How Often Do I Need to Season My Fish & Veggie Grill Tray?

Season the tray whenever you notice the seasoning coating starts to deteriorate.

How to Season Your Fish & Veggie Stainless Steel Grill Tray

  1. Wash with soap and water. Dry thoroughly.
  2. Heat your Traeger® Grill to 400°F (204°C). Place Fish & Veggie Grill Tray inside the grill to heat.
  3. Once the Fish & Veggie Grill Tray is hot, pour a small amount of high-smoke-point oil (we recommend avocado or refined vegetable oil) onto a paper towel and wipe across all internal surfaces of the tray. Do not use too much oil – it’s better to apply in small amounts over multiple sessions.
  4. Place the tray back into the grill; then remove after 10 minutes or when the oil starts to lightly smoke.
  5. Once cool, use a clean paper towel to wipe off any excess oil.
  6. Repeat as desired.

How to Clean Your Fish & Veggie Stainless Steel Grill Tray

  1. Allow the Fish & Veggie Grill Tray to cool.
  2. Clean with regular dish soap with a plastic scraper, stiff brush, or dish sponge.
    • Avoid steel sponges.
    • Burned or sticky foods should always be scraped and cleaned from the surface.
  3. Before cooking, pour small amounts of high-smoke-point oil (we recommend avocado or refined vegetable oil) onto a paper towel and wipe across all internal surfaces of the tray.
    • Do not use too much oil.
